In this episode we define Lagniappe, the word that the entire project is built around. We also visit Stew Leonard's, one of the best examples of a company that gets it.

Here's how Wikipedia defines it:
Lagniappe - A lagniappe is a small gift given to a customer by a merchant at the time of a purchase (such as a 13th doughnut when buying a dozen), or more broadly, "something given or obtained gratuitously or by way of good measure."

As many of you know, I co-hosted a video podcast with Stan Phelps called The Purple Goldfish Project. I have always been passionate about great client relationships and exciting marketing, so it was a no-brainer and an honor to get on board with it.

The goal of the project was to gather 1001 examples of marketing lagniappe. The little something extra a business does to surprise and delight you. That way of going above and beyond that inspires loyalty and word of mouth.

The project was a success and Stan has even published a book called What's Your Purple Goldfish? How to Win Customers and Influence Word of Mouth.
